Forbes DJ Rich List 2014

The man from Dumfries does it again!

This week saw the American business magazine Forbes announce their DJ rich list for 2014 seeing Calvin Harris earn an estimated $20m more than 2013. He is not only the world’s richest DJ, he is also the second richest UK musician under the age of 30 and ‘a powerful celebrity’…all according to Forbes. The DJ rich list is put together using estimates of how much artists earn from gigs, merchandise, endorsements, external business ventures and sales of actual music. Other movers and shakers see Deadmau5 and Tiesto slipping, Avicii climbing three places and DJ Pauly D saying goodbye. Here’s da list…

Forbes’ DJ Rich List 2014

1. Calvin Harris $66m
2. David Guetta $30m
3. Avicii $28m
4. Tiësto $28m
5. Steve Aoki $23m
6. Afrojack $22m
7. Zedd $21m
8. Kaskade $17m
9. Skrillex $16.5
10. Deadmau5 $16
